①插入windows10安装光盘,从光盘启动,在光盘启动完成后,按下shift+f10键,调出cmd命令提示符。
②在命令提示符中输入:bcdboot x:windows /s x:注意,这前一个x:是windows7的windows文件夹所在的盘,一般是c:,如果不是c盘,请改为对应的盘符。
这后一个x:是活动主分区的盘符所在,一般也是c盘。所以这个命令一般的写法是:bcdboot c:windows /s c:。但需要注意,在windows re环境下所看到的盘符与在windows7下所看到的盘符未必一样。
③需要首先用dir /a命令确认各盘是否正确。比如:cd /d c:dir /a这两个命令的作用是,首先进入c:盘的根目录,然后显示c盘根目录下的所有文件和文件夹,根据所显示的文件或者文件夹,可以判断这个盘具体是在 windows7下所看到的哪一个盘。
windows7的引导文件主要是bootmgr和boot文件夹里面的文件,而boot文件夹里面的文件主要是bcd文件。
④bcdboot命令会在指定的分区内重新写入全部windows10的引导文件。
如果只是bcd文件有问题,则可以用bootrec命令重建bcd:插入windows7安装光盘,从光盘启动,在光盘启动完成后,按下shift+f10键,调出cmd命令提示符。
⑤在命令提示符中输入:bootrec /RebuildBcd,这个命令如果搜到没有写入bcd的windows7或者vista的 *** 作系统,会提示是否写入,按提示输入Y也就会写入了的。完成。
造成此类故障的重要原因是磁盘引导分区信息丢失所造成的。
联想笔记本开机 no bootable device的解决步骤如下:
1、首先选择 *** 作系统引导方法,重启开机并在出现第一画面时,按“DEL”或其它指定键盘按键进入CMOS界面。
2、在进入CMOS设置界面,在“启动类型”选择界面中,选择从“硬盘启动”项。
3、如果从硬盘启动失败,则可以利用相关PE工具对引导分区进行修复。例如可以利用“U启动”PE工具,在进入桌面后,点击“Windows引导启动修复”工具对引导分区进行修复。
4、也可以利用“DiskGenius分区工具”对引导分区进行修复。在其程序主界面中,右击要修复的分区,从d出的右键菜单中选择“重建主引导记录”项进行修复。
5、在利用U启动还原系统时,也会提供“修复引导分区”的选项,只需要勾选即可对引导分区进行修复。
6、最后点击引导修复,问题就解决了。
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)